适用于ios的SSH2库

时间:2011-07-22 17:44:27

标签: objective-c ios networking ssl ssh

ios有没有高质量的SSH2库?

对于java,有一个名为jsch(http://www.jcraft.com/jsch/)的库,它可以很好地包装ssh2。我最感兴趣的一点功能是“反向端口转发”方法:

session.setPortForwardingR(remote_port, host, local_port);

我从http://www.chilkatsoft.com/ssh-sftp-objc.asp找到了一个Objective-c lib,但它不是免费的,似乎没有达到高质量水平。我应该尝试移植openssh的C版本吗?

另外,如果移植openssh是最好的选择,那么目前有没有开源项目呢?

2 个答案:

答案 0 :(得分:8)

答案 1 :(得分:2)

我可能会考虑查看libssh。乍一看,它看起来像C的吸引人的选择。它可能可以通过一些努力为iPhone编译。